Export & trade economy course syllabus
The recommended order for Export & Trade Economy of Garment Manufacturing: 6 modules covering 14 industry chapters and 15 value chain stages, each module closing with a quiz. About 12–16 hours of reading and quizzes at your own pace.
- Module 1 of 6
1. Export markets and buyer demand
Read market signals and buyer behaviour to judge which export orders are worth chasing.
Prerequisite: No prior module required; basic garment manufacturing knowledge is helpful.
